Hrithik Roshan to be paid 50 cr for Mohenjo Daro?

Superstars and number games continue to shock. Buzz
is, Hrithik Roshan will not take the profit sharing route but will be
paid Rs 50 crore for Ashutosh Gowariker's period romance Mohenjo Daro. The actor's astronomical fee has raised eyebrows
since the filmmaker is yet to find a studio ready to back him and the
box-office fate of Hrithik's next, Siddharth Anand's action thriller
Bang Bang is still not known.
According to a source close to the development, the director is in advanced talks with a leading studio. “The modalities are being worked out and the studio will come on board in the next 15 days. Hrithik's first-of-its-kind pay structure has been taken into account,“ says the source.
Says trade analyst Amod Mehra, “This will make Hrithik the highest paid actor in the country and Mohenjo Daro the most expensive film.“
Exhibitor Manoj Desai won't predict the fate of Mohenjo Daro but is confident that Hrithik continues to be a crowdpuller. “He was brilliant in Ashutosh's period drama Jodhaa Akbar and Mohenjo Daro is also a period drama."
Despite repeated attempts, Hrithik remained unavailable for comment.
